Potential Supplements to Consider:

  • CoQ10: Essential for mitochondrial electron transport, helping to boost energy output.
  • PQQ (Pyrroloquinoline Quinone): Supports mitochondrial biogenesis – the creation of new mitochondria.
  • D-Ribose: A carbohydrate that aids in ATP production, the cellular fuel source.
  • Alpha-Lipoic Acid (ALA): Acts as an antioxidant and assists mitochondrial function, also involved in energy processing.
  • Creatine: While often associated with physical performance, it can also support brain energy and mitochondrial activity.
  • NADH: A coenzyme directly involved in energy processes; supplementing may improve energy levels.

Remember, addressing chronic fatigue is a comprehensive journey, involving diet, lifestyle modifications, and addressing underlying factors. Supplementation is just one aspect of the puzzle, and should be used under the supervision of a knowledgeable healthcare provider.

Supporting Chronic Fatigue & Mitochondrial Function: Potential Strategies

Chronic fatigue syndrome (CFS), also known as myalgic encephalomyelitis (ME), is a debilitating condition frequently linked to dysfunctional mitochondrial performance. Mitochondria are responsible for generating cellular energy, and when they aren't operating efficiently, it can lead to the pervasive lethargy and other symptoms characteristic of CFS. While no single treatment is a guaranteed cure, several nutrients show promise in enhancing mitochondrial health and potentially alleviating some of the burden of chronic fatigue. Exploring options such as CoQ10, which plays a crucial role in the electron transport chain; L-Carnitine, involved in fatty acid metabolism and energy generation; and Alpha-Lipoic Acid (ALA), a powerful antioxidant that can boost mitochondrial performance are worth investigating. Furthermore, certain B compounds, magnesium, and D-Ribose may also contribute to mitochondrial support. Importantly remember that it’s essential to speak with with a qualified healthcare expert before initiating any new regimen, as individual needs and responses can differ significantly, and potential medications may interact.
